Council Considers Demolition Instead Of Fire Safety Upgrades

Residents in a Harlow apartments block are facing the prospect of relocation as Harlow Council considers the option of demolition, deeming it more economically viable than the £5.5 million required for fire safety upgrades recommended post-Grenfell.

Huge Financial Implications From Skip Hire Site Fire

Demolition costs for Lancaster fire may rise to £900k for Lancaster City Council who are grappling with a financial quandary in the aftermath of a massive fire at a former skip hire site. The potential demolition costs, estimated at £900,000, have prompted the council to consider various options to address the consequences of the fire that consumed a significant amount of waste.
